Adaptation to Suburban and Urban Landscapes One of the most remarkable aspects of the blue jay's habitat is its seamless integration into human-altered landscapes. Woodland edges and transitional zones offer the highest diversity of food and cover.

They rely heavily on nuts, acorns, and berries, often caching food for later consumption. They favor areas with a tall, mature canopy composed of oaks, beeches, and hickories, which provide essential food sources like acorns and beechnuts.
